Consultation on school admission arrangements for 2011-2012
Parents, community groups and any other interested parties are informed that a consultation is underway on school admissions arrangements for the academic year 2011-12 for all community and controlled schools within the borough of Warrington.
The proposed admission arrangements for all community and controlled schools for which the local authority is the admission authority can be viewed at the Children and Young People's Services Directorate, New Town House, Buttermarket Street, Warrington WA1 2NJ between 9am and 5pm Monday to Friday, or you can download them here:

If you would like to reply to the consultation you must do so before 1 March 2010 and responses should be sent to the admissions and transport manager, Children and Young People's Services, New Town House, Buttermarket Street, Warrington, WA1 2NJ.
The proposed admission arrangements for all church aided schools within the borough of Warrington can be obtained directly from the schools. These schools are now only required to consult every three years unless they are making any changes to their admissions policy or arrangements set for 2010-11. Responses to these consultations must be sent direct to the chair of governors of the appropriate school by the date stipulated by the school.
